Nyxoah SA Ordinary Shares (NYXH), a medical technology firm focused on innovative therapies for obstructive sleep apnea, recently released its the previous quarter earnings results. Per public disclosures, the company reported a quarterly adjusted earnings per share (EPS) of -0.586, with no corresponding revenue figures made available as part of this earnings release. Management Commentary
During the accompanying earnings call, NYXH leadership focused discussion primarily on operational milestones achieved in the previous quarter, rather than granular financial breakdowns, given the absence of reported revenue for the quarter. Management highlighted progress in enrollment for late-stage clinical trials of its lead neurostimulation therapy platform, noting that recruitment rates were in line with internal targets for the period. They also referenced ongoing efforts to secure additional regulatory clearances for the platform in key high-growth markets, as well as cross-functional cost-control initiatives implemented to extend the company’s cash runway. Leadership acknowledged the quarterly negative EPS, noting that the figure was largely driven by planned R&D investments in next-generation product iterations and one-time costs associated with supply chain optimization for future commercial production, with no further line-item financial breakdowns provided in public filings. Forward Guidance
NYXH did not issue formal quantitative forward guidance as part of its the previous quarter earnings release, per public disclosures. Instead, leadership provided qualitative outlook notes, pointing to potential key milestones in upcoming periods that could shape the company’s operational trajectory. These include anticipated regulatory decisions for its lead therapy in core North American and European markets, planned expansion of commercial partnerships to support future product launches, and ongoing efforts to reduce non-core operating expenses to align with the company’s current commercialization timeline. Analysts covering the stock have noted that the lack of quantitative guidance may contribute to near-term uncertainty around investor sentiment, as market participants wait for additional clarity on the company’s path to initial revenue generation and long-term profitability. No specific timelines for revenue launch were shared in the official release.

Market Reaction
In the trading sessions immediately following the the previous quarter earnings release, NYXH saw mixed price action, with trading volume slightly above average in the first two days post-release before returning to normal levels. Sell-side analysts covering the stock have published mixed notes in response to the results: some have emphasized the steady progress on clinical and regulatory fronts as potential long-term positives for the company, while others have raised questions about the pace of cost optimization and the expected timeline for initial revenue recognition, given the absence of revenue data in the Q4 release. Broader medtech sector trends have also influenced sentiment, as pre-commercial peers with similar product development timelines have seen comparable mixed market reactions to earnings releases with limited financial metrics in recent weeks. NYXH’s share price could see additional volatility in upcoming periods as investors await further updates on regulatory progress and commercial launch plans.
